Transaction dc7fbbfc2843ccac91c135d3319555be60470f23ac6eee37d874aaf34bda4839

1 Input
2 Outputs
  • dc7fbbfc2843ccac91c135d3319555be60470f23ac6eee37d874aaf34bda4839:0
  • value  1106845
    address  3NejfUFSyDVuWz7LzPFPyVqyV9VwPv4wVP
  • dc7fbbfc2843ccac91c135d3319555be60470f23ac6eee37d874aaf34bda4839:1
  • value  6081996
    address  17KKcEhJcoN6rwhGi91FA8RqN4ZszKGX8U